Schmersal Magnetic Actuator - BPS 260-1


This magnetic actuator from Schmersal activates the switching of the BNS 260 range of non-contact switches. Its compact size makes it ideal for use in applications where there's limited space, while its rugged, corrosion-resistant housing of glass fibre-reinforced thermoplastic tolerates challenging industrial environments. The magnet assembly is sealed to an IP67 (ingress protection) rating, so it's dust-tight and submersible. So you can feel confident in your workplace safety, this device has a tamper-resistant design that prevents bypassing with a simple magnet or improperly coded magnetic field.

How does a magnetic switch work?


Magnetic switches work in a similar way to relays by using a magnetic field to switch over an electrical contact.

What are the advantages of magnetic switches over traditional relays?


Magnetic switches are sealed in plastic, which eliminates sparking hazards in explosive or flammable environments. They also have lower contact resistances, faster switching speeds and longer lifes.
